What is UPVC?

UPVC is a type of plastic that is widely utilized in the building market, especially for doors and window frames. Unlike routine PVC, UPVC does not contain plasticizers, that makes it rigid and appropriate for structural applications. The product is resistant to moisture and environmental deterioration, offering it a longer life expectancy compared to traditional materials like wood and metal.

Benefits of UPVC Windows and Doors

  1. Toughness: UPVC is extremely resistant to rot, corrosion, and fading, making it an outstanding option for environments with severe climate condition.

  2. Energy Efficiency: UPVC frames can help enhance the energy efficiency of homes. They are outstanding insulators, which suggests they can assist decrease heating and cooling expenses.

  3. Low Maintenance: Unlike wood frames that may need routine painting and sealing, UPVC can simply be cleaned up with soap and water, preserving its look with very little effort.

  4. Economical: Although the initial investment might be greater than aluminum or wooden choices, the long life-span and low maintenance requirements of UPVC make it a more economical option with time.

  5. Visually Pleasing: UPVC doors and windows been available in numerous designs and colors, making sure house owners can find an option that complements their property.

Kinds Of UPVC Windows and Doors

UPVC products can be found in various styles to fit various architectural styles and individual choices. Some common types consist of:

Windows:

  1. Casement Windows: Hinged at the side, these windows open outside, supplying exceptional ventilation.
  2. Sliding Windows: These windows run on a track, enabling easy opening and closing.
  3. Sash Windows: Featuring sliding panes, sash windows offer a standard look and performance.
  4. Tilt and Turn Windows: Versatile in style, these windows can tilt for ventilation or turn fully for simple cleaning.

Doors:

  1. UPVC Front Doors: Designed to supply security and insulation, these doors are offered in numerous designs.
  2. French Doors: These double doors open outward and create a seamless link to outside areas.
  3. Sliding Patio Doors: Ideal for taking full advantage of views and natural light, these doors run smoothly along a track.
  4. Bi-fold Doors: These doors can fold back to develop an open area, ideal for amusing or linking indoor and outside areas.

Installation Process

The installation of UPVC doors and windows is important for ensuring their performance and longevity. Here are the key actions associated with the setup process:

  1. Measurement: Accurate measurements of the existing openings are taken.

  2. Preparation: The old frames are eliminated, and the location is cleaned up and prepped for the new installation.

  3. Placement: The new UPVC frames are placed, ensuring they fit comfortably within the openings.

  4. Sealing: The frames are sealed using proper sealing materials to prevent drafts and water ingress.

  5. Finishing: Final changes are made to guarantee the windows and doors operate smoothly, and any finishing touches are included.

Maintenance Tips for UPVC Windows and Doors

To keep UPVC windows and doors in good condition, the following upkeep tips are suggested: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Use a wet fabric or sponge with mild soap to wipe down the frames and glass surfaces. Prevent harsh chemicals that can damage the product.

  2. Examine Seals and Locks: Regularly check the sealing and locking systems to ensure they are functioning properly.

  3. Lube Moving Parts: Use a silicone-based lubricant on hinges and locks to keep them running smoothly.

  4. Inspect for Damage: Periodically inspect for any noticeable damage or wear to deal with issues before they intensify.

Frequently Asked Questions About UPVC Windows and Doors

  1. How long do UPVC windows and doors last?

    • UPVC windows and doors can last upwards of 20 years with appropriate upkeep.
  2. Are UPVC products energy effective?

    • Yes, UPVC uses exceptional insulation properties, which can significantly boost energy performance in homes.
  3. Can UPVC windows be painted?

    • While UPVC can be painted, it's normally not advised, as this might void warranties and impact the product's stability.
  4. Are UPVC products recyclable?

    • Yes, UPVC is recyclable, making it an ecologically friendly option.
  5. Can I set up UPVC windows and doors myself?

    • While DIY installation is possible, it is recommended to work with professionals for proper and safe and secure setup.
